How to prepare for a job interview at Energy Jobline ZR
β¨Know Your Engineering Basics
Brush up on your Level 3 Engineering knowledge and be ready to discuss key concepts. Make sure you can explain your fault-finding skills with real examples from your past experiences.
β¨Understand High-Speed Automation
Familiarise yourself with high-speed production environments and the specific challenges they present. Be prepared to talk about how you've contributed to reliability and continuous improvement in similar settings.
β¨Showcase Your Problem-Solving Skills
Prepare to discuss specific instances where you've tackled maintenance issues effectively.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ers and highlight your proactive approach.
β¨Ask Insightful Questions
Come equipped with questions that show your interest in the role and the company. Inquire about their maintenance strategies, training opportunities, and how they measure success in the position.
